Biomancer Adapt infinite combos

Hi guys this is my first attempt to build a deck using some of the new Guild os Ravnica cards. As you can see there are two infinite combos in this deck: Incubation druid + Vigean Graftmage = infinite mana , also cast Hydroid Krasis to draw your entire library and cast Nexus of fate on each turn for infinite turns. Also, Walking Ballista + two copies of Training Grounds or Biomancer´s Familiar = gg.  Besides, you can Abuse from Kefnet´s Ability using the cost reduction , the same for Nature Shapers giving sometimes infinite counters and draw to complete de combo pieces. It's worth noting that the Walking Ballista + two copies of Training Grounds or Biomancer´s Familiar might be game if you have enough mana, but it's not infinite because of the one cost minimum restriction.
